Abstract

This invention relates to image correction device and image correction method for compensating both the contrast and the brightness of the original image, suppressing the contrast enhancement, improving the lightness, and transforming an image with extremely bright areas or extremely dark areas into an image with correct contrast and lightness. To correct the contrast, the original image is divided into a plurality of areas, a histogram fabricated to show the frequency distribution for the pixel lightness in each area and a lightness mapping curve made for the accumulated value. The pixel lightness for each area within the image is converted based on the lightness mapping curve. To correct the lightness of the original image, the average lightness is compensated when determined to be extremely bright or extremely dark.
